The Bobbington housing market reflects the character of this desirable South Staffordshire village, where property values have shown notable growth according to recent data. Our research indicates that the average sold price in Bobbington reached approximately £535,000 over the last twelve months, with Rightmove reporting average prices around £595,000 for the same period. The wider DY7 postcode area, which encompasses Bobbington and surrounding villages, shows a broader price range spanning from £425,000 to £925,000, with an average of £645,825.
Year-on-year price performance in Bobbington has been particularly striking, with Rightmove data indicating sold prices were 71% up on the previous year and now sitting 5% above the 2022 peak of £567,000. This substantial increase warrants careful interpretation, as the village's relatively small transaction volume means each sale can significantly influence percentage movements. The market benefits from strong demand for properties in this scenic corner of Staffordshire, where buyers are drawn to the rural character and excellent transport connections to Birmingham and the West Midlands.
Property types available in Bobbington lean heavily toward detached and semi-detached homes, reflecting the village's rural setting and the preferences of buyers seeking space and privacy. Our current listings show detached properties commanding an average of £690,667, while semi-detached homes average £377,500. The market skews toward family-sized accommodation, with four-bedroom homes representing the largest segment of available stock at an average price of £743,800. Zoopla records 226 properties with recorded sold prices in the DY7 area, demonstrating consistent transaction activity despite the village's modest size.

Bedroom count significantly influences property values in the Bobbington market, with our current listing data revealing clear price bands across different property sizes. Four-bedroom homes represent the largest segment of available properties, commanding an average price of £743,800 and appealing to families seeking spacious accommodation in the rural South Staffordshire area. These larger properties attract buyers who need home office space, guest accommodation, or simply appreciate the room that country living affords. Three-bedroom homes at an average of £427,488 represent the most accessible entry point to the market, while two-bedroom properties remain relatively scarce with just one listing averaging £350,000.
New build activity specifically within Bobbington's DY7 5 postcode remains limited according to available research, with no major verified developments currently active within the village itself. The surrounding area does occasionally see small-scale developments and conversions, such as executive canal-side schemes and barn conversions that appeal to buyers seeking modern conveniences in traditional settings. This relative scarcity of new build stock means that period properties and character homes form the backbone of the Bobbington market, with many properties dating back to the 19th and early 20th centuries.

Bobbington occupies a picturesque position in South Staffordshire, nestled between the market towns of Stourbridge and Kidderminster while remaining within easy reach of Birmingham. The village retains a rural character with a scattering of historic farms, period cottages, and more substantial country houses that reflect the area's agricultural heritage. The surrounding countryside offers excellent walking and riding opportunities, with the Staffordshire Way crossing nearby and the tranquil canal network providing scenic routes for recreation. The area is particularly popular with professionals commuting to Birmingham and the wider West Midlands, who appreciate the village atmosphere while maintaining straightforward access to major employment centres.
Transportation links from Bobbington serve both commuters and families, with the nearby stations at Stourbridge and Kidderminster providing rail connections to Birmingham and Worcester. Road access via the A449 and M5 motorway makes the village accessible for those working in the West Midlands while maintaining its peaceful village atmosphere. Local amenities include traditional pubs, countryside walks, and community facilities that contribute to the area's appeal for families and retirees alike seeking a quieter lifestyle without sacrificing connectivity. The A449 trunk road provides direct access to Wolverhampton and Birmingham, making this area particularly attractive for those who need to travel regularly for work.
The housing stock in Bobbington and surrounding villages predominantly consists of detached and semi-detached properties built using traditional methods, with many homes constructed using local red brick and tile that characterises Staffordshire villages. The absence of significant flood risk data for the immediate area suggests that properties generally sit on stable ground, though prospective buyers should always conduct appropriate surveys when purchasing period properties. Sellers in Bobbington can choose between traditional high-street estate agents with local presence and online agents offering fixed-fee structures. Berriman Eaton operates from Wombourne and maintains a strong local presence in the South Staffordshire market, with an average asking price of £714,475 across their current listings, positioning them toward the premium end of the market. Bartlams, trading through Skitts Estate Agents, focuses on properties averaging £455,000 and commands 18.2% market share, demonstrating their strength in the mid-market segment.
The choice between percentage-based and fixed-fee arrangements depends on your property type and selling price expectations. Traditional agents like Hunters, who currently market a property at £515,000 in the area, typically charge between 1% and 3% plus VAT of the final sale price, with the average around 1.5% plus VAT. Online agents such as Exp Luxury, currently listing a £1,000,000 property in Bobbington, offer fixed fees typically ranging from £999 to £1,999, which can prove cost-effective for higher-value properties but may offer less personal service and local market knowledge. Multi-agency agreements, where you instruct more than one agent simultaneously, typically incur higher total fees but can expand your property's exposure across different agent databases and client networks.
Estate agent fees are often negotiable, particularly for higher-value properties, and you shouldn't be afraid to discuss the fee structure with agents and ask if they can offer a discount in exchange for exclusive sole agency rights. Getting quotes from multiple agents gives you leverage in negotiations and ensures you secure the best possible representation for your property. Sole agency agreements remain the most common approach in the Bobbington market, typically running for fixed terms of 8 to 16 weeks. Compare Agents FreeBased on current market share data, Bartlams (Skitts Estate Agents) and Berriman Eaton (Be-Essential.Com) lead the Bobbington market, each commanding 18.2% of active listings. Bartlams focuses on properties averaging £455,000, while Berriman Eaton operates at the higher end with properties averaging £714,475. Other active agents include Eden Midcalf from Kinver, Hunters from Stourbridge, Exp Luxury, Dourish & Day from Penkridge, and Nock Deighton, offering diverse options across different price points and specialisms. The presence of agents from surrounding towns like Wombourne, Stourbridge, and Kidderminster demonstrates the cross-border nature of the local property market.
Estate agent fees in Bobbington follow national patterns, typically ranging from 1% to 3% plus VAT (1.2% to 3.6% including VAT) of the final sale price for traditional percentage-based agents. The average fee sits around 1.5% plus VAT, which translates to approximately £6,825 on a property at the current average asking price of £455,000. Online fixed-fee agents charge between £999 and £1,999 regardless of sale price, which can prove economical for higher-value properties but may offer less personal service and local market expertise. Many agents are open to negotiation, particularly for properties at the upper end of the market.
Yes, Rightmove data indicates that sold prices in Bobbington were 71% up on the previous year and now sit 5% above the 2022 peak of £567,000. However, this significant percentage increase reflects the relatively low transaction volume in this small village, where individual sales can disproportionately affect percentage movements. Zoopla reports average sold prices around £535,000 over the last twelve months, while Rightmove shows approximately £595,000. TheDY7 postcode area shows a broader average of £645,825, suggesting Bobbington itself sits slightly below the wider area average.
